Amjad El‐Qanni is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Materials Chemistry and Organic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Amjad El‐Qanni has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 410 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Water Science and Technology, 7 papers in Materials Chemistry and 6 papers in Organic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Amjad El‐Qanni's work include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(6 papers), Adsorption and biosorption for pollutant removal (6 papers) and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(4 papers). Amjad El‐Qanni is often cited by papers focused on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(6 papers), Adsorption and biosorption for pollutant removal (6 papers) and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(4 papers). Amjad El‐Qanni collaborates with scholars based in Palestinian Territory, Canada and Italy. Amjad El‐Qanni's co-authors include Maryam Hmoudah, Nashaat N. Nassar, Gerardo Vitale, Azfar Hassan, Vincenzo Russo, Nedal N. Marei, Abdulnaser Ibrahim Nour, Martino Di Serio, Amer El‐Hamouz and Riccardo Tesser and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Langmuir and Scientific Reports.
